第九章 磁盤分區建立和管理

第九章 磁盤分區建立和管理linux


第一節 建立磁盤分區ide


  1. 查看當前磁盤分區信息ui

    fdisk -lthis

    wKiom1YJ5k2xf0XkAAI2_maa6qI205.jpg

    看到只有一塊硬盤設備即/dev/sda。spa


  2. 添加一塊新的硬盤設備3d

    在線加入一塊新的15GB硬盤,新添加的15GB硬盤必需要重啓Linux系統才能夠被系統識別出來,不然直接運行fdisk -l命令是沒法顯示新添加的硬盤設備信息。blog

    如何實現不重啓Linux系統,便可在線識別到新添加的硬盤設備?內存

    具體實現方式爲:從新掃描分區表信息 ci

    #echo "- - -" > /sys/class/scsi_host/host0/scanget

    wKiom1YJ61vTI4f8AAOGpDWesu0057.jpg

    從新掃描分區表信息後,運行fdisk -l發現識別到新添加的硬盤設備即/dev/sdb。


  3. 對/dev/sdb建立分區


進入命令交互模式


[root@localhost ~]# fdisk /dev/sdb

歡迎使用 fdisk (util-linux 2.23.2)。

更改將停留在內存中,直到您決定將更改寫入磁盤。

使用寫入命令前請三思。

Device does not contain a recognized partition table

使用磁盤標識符 0x101ed085 建立新的 DOS 磁盤標籤。


命令(輸入 m 獲取幫助):m

命令操做

   a   toggle a bootable flag                            設置可引導標記

   b   edit bsd disklabel                                編輯bsd磁盤標籤

   c   toggle the dos compatibility flag                 設置dos兼容性

   d   delete a partition                                刪除一個分區

   g   create a new empty GPT partition table            建立一個新的空的GPT分區表

   G   create an IRIX (SGI) partition table              建立IRIX分區表

   l   list known partition types                        列出分區類型

   m   print this menu                                   顯示幫助信息

   n   add a new partition                               添加一個新分區

   o   create a new empty DOS partition table            建立一個新的空的DOS分區表

   p   print the partition table                         輸出分區表

   q   quit without saving changes                       退出操做,不保存修改

   s   create a new empty Sun disklabel                  建立一個新的空的Sun磁盤標籤

   t   change a partition's system id                    更改系統分區表id號

   u   change display/entry units                        更改顯示記錄

   v   verify the partition table                        對分區表進行覈實

   w   write table to disk and exit                      退出並保存所作的修改

   x   extra functionality (experts only)                特殊功能


建立主分區

wKiom1YJ8rLxinuNAAL1sd8LMoQ096.jpg


建立擴展分區並建立邏輯分區

wKiom1YJ8v_ze3ZhAAS1TSfadvk220.jpg


格式化分區

格式化主分區

wKiom1YJ90-Cs_UJAANBb_2glF8065.jpg

格式化邏輯分區

wKioL1YJ9-fB_kttAAMjvlY47L0800.jpg

備註:有時在新建立的分區上沒法使用mkfs格式化當前分區,提示設備正忙、沒有那個文件或目錄。

這時,能夠運行partprobe命令,再進行格式化操做。


第二節 查看磁盤分區信息


fdisk -l    顯示磁盤與分區詳細信息

wKiom1YJ88LiYSUIAAP7fn80B_g116.jpg

cat /proc/partitions    顯示分區表信息

wKiom1YJ9FHAGsBQAAESzpHVOCM714.jpg

parted -l    詳細顯示磁盤分區大小、類型和文件系統類型信息

wKiom1YJ-DqT4w3GAAMdWhW4-kQ266.jpg

blkid    顯示已建立的文件系統的UUID和Type

wKiom1YJ-HvQb8d2AAIaGS-OJbA506.jpg   

第三節 磁盤分區掛載

查看已掛載設備磁盤使用狀況

df -Th

wKiom1YJ-W6TUSUmAAGD03tHqKY834.jpg

臨時掛載--即系統重啓後掛載信息丟失

[root@localhost ~]# mount /dev/sdb1 /AppData    將/dev/sdb1掛載到/AppData目錄

[root@localhost ~]# mount /dev/sdb5 /Data       將/dev/sdb5掛載到/Data目錄

wKioL1YJ-oPjlN81AAIfnphcwMY030.jpg

永久掛載

[root@localhost ~]# vi /etc/fstab    編輯掛載信息

wKioL1YJ_Z6RWTIBAAKwN5YN2RA804.jpg

相關文章
相關標籤/搜索